How to Estimate Calorie Needs

Basal Metabolic Rate (BMR) = 24 * Weight (kg)

then multiply by activity level

Sedentary = BMR * 1.45
Light = BMR * 1.60
Medium = BMR * 1.70
Heavy = BMR * 1.88

this is an estmate of the calories to maintain current weight, age, muscle, metabolism will all change this number.

I usually calculate mine as sedentary then add my training. but remember this is only an estimate and should only be considered as a starting point.
